    the further down the social pyramid you go. Social classes‚ and what class you were in‚ determined what clothes you wore‚ what food you ate‚ what jobs you had‚ and various other matters of life. Rome was divided into five classes: the senators‚ equestrians‚ commons‚ freed people‚ and slaves. The senators were men who served in the Senate. This class was dominated by the nobles which meant they had to have an ancestor who previously had political power. The senators would decide on the laws of the

    Donatello’s equestrian statue of Erasmo better known as the Gattamelata was built in 1453‚ during the middle of the Italian Renaissance. This statue stands 11 feet tall and was the first example of such a monument since ancient times. There were other statues of such scale in the 14th century but none that had been created in bronze and all were placed over tombs rather than erected to be a standalone piece.
